●● Tragedy of the Commons
Answer: the depletion of shared resources by people acting in individual
interest
●● Triple Bottom Line
Answer: approach to sustainability that meets environmental, economic,
and social goals (business)
●● Inorganic Compounds
Answer: compounds that lack carbon and hydrogen atoms
●● Organic Compounds
Answer: compounds that contain carbon-based molecules
●● Positive Feedback Loop
Answer: when the response to a stimulus increases the original stimulus
●● Negative Feedback Loop
,Answer: when the response to a stimulus decreases the effect of the
original stimulus
●● Overshoot
Answer: when a population exceeds the long term carrying capacity for
an environment
●● Open System
Answer: a system in which matter can enter from or escape to the
surroundings
●● Closed System
Answer: a system that allows the exchange of energy (not
matter)between the system and its surroundings
●● Holistic
Answer: emphasizing the functional relationship between parts and the
whole
●● Hectare
Answer: a unit of surface area equal to 100 ares
●● Ecological Footprint
, Answer: a way of measuring how much of an impact a person or
community has on the earth
●● Sustainable Development
Answer: development that meets the needs of the present without
compromising the ability of future generations
●● Environmental Justice
Answer: recognition that access to a clean, healthy environment is a
fundamental right
●● Biodiversity
Answer: the variety of species living within an ecosystem
●● In situ
Answer: in the original or natural place or site
●● Ex situ
Answer: off-site conservation; outside location
●● Inbreeding Depression
Answer: the negative consequences in a population when genetically
similar parents reproduce weak offspring
